Sobre o Autor

Sobre o autor de Pensamento Visual para o Design da Informação

Colin Ware, autor de Visual Thinking for Design, é um renomado especialista em visualização de dados e um acadêmico interdisciplinar que une a psicologia da percepção à ciência da computação. Professor na Universidade de New Hampshire, ele dirige o Data Visualization Research Lab e possui nomeações duplas em Engenharia Oceânica e Ciência da Computação.

Seu livro explora como os seres humanos processam informações visuais, baseando-se em seu doutorado em psicologia da percepção (Universidade de Toronto) e mestrado em ciência da computação (Universidade de Waterloo), posicionando-o como uma leitura essencial para designers e pesquisadores.

A obra seminal de Ware, Information Visualization: Perception for Design (4ª edição), tornou-se um livro-texto fundamental na área, traduzido para vários idiomas e citado em mais de 150 artigos revisados por pares. Eleito para a IEEE Visualization Academy em 2020, sua pesquisa combina rigor teórico com aplicações práticas, influenciando o mapeamento oceânico, o design de interfaces e a visualização científica. Suas estruturas são utilizadas por organizações como o National Research Council e instituições acadêmicas globalmente.

Visual Thinking for Design tem sido celebrado por sua síntese acessível da ciência da percepção e princípios de design, com edições revisadas que refletem décadas de avanços interdisciplinares.
